Character
Chip Plankton II is a character that appears in the episode "Karen's Baby."
Description
Baby
He is a small silver calculator with green eyes and a light pink baby bonnet.
Child
He is a mini silver typewriter with skinny arms and legs and green eyes. He also has paper sticking out of his head.
Teenager
He is a video game console that resembles a Game Boy Advance. He has a skinny body with skinny arms and legs, a green mouth and eyes on his screen, and wears a backwards red cap.
Young Adult
He is a mobile computer like his mother Karen. He carries a red backpack and has a green mouth and eyes on his screen.
Adult
He is a full grown ATM that wears a red tie and a nametag. He also still has his same green eyes and has arms.

Trivia
- This is the third character named "Chip" in the series, the first being Chip (food) and the second being Chip (fish).
- He was named after Karen's grandfather.
